Nagarjuna, a versatile figure in the Indian entertainment industry, has etched his legacy as an accomplished actor, film producer, television host, and entrepreneur. Renowned for his contributions to Telugu cinema, as well as forays into Hindi and Tamil films, he stands as a recipient of two National Film Awards. Notably, his production “Ninne Pelladata” (1996) earned the Best Feature Film in Telugu, while his portrayal in “Annamayya” (1997) garnered a Special Mention.

The recipient of nine state Nandi Awards and three Filmfare Awards South, Nagarjuna also played a pivotal role as a major shareholder in Maa TV, a popular Telugu channel. His hosting prowess shone through in the Telugu version of “Who Wants to Be a Millionaire?” titled “Meelo Evaru Koteeswarudu.” Furthermore, he took on the mantle of hosting multiple seasons of the reality show “Bigg Boss.”

Beyond the realm of entertainment, Nagarjuna has demonstrated a keen entrepreneurial spirit. As a co-owner of the Mumbai Masters in the Indian Badminton League and the Mahi Racing Team India with MS Dhoni, he has left an imprint on sports as well. Alongside his wife Amala, Nagarjuna co-founded the Blue Cross of Hyderabad, a recognized NGO dedicated to animal welfare.
